Indonesia halts 190 mining firms failing to provide reclamation and post-mining guarantees
Indonesia's Ministry of Energy and Mineral Resources (ESDM) has imposed temporary operational suspensions on 190 mining companies for failing to meet environmental obligations by providing reclamation and post-mining guarantees, according to an official sanction letter on September 18.
The sanctions, signed by Director General of Minerals and Coal Tri Winarno on behalf of the ESDM, come after inactive responses to three previous administrative warnings on December 10, 2024, May 16, 2025, and August 5, 2025.
Government Regulation No. 78 of 2010 and Ministerial Regulation No. 26 of 2018 require mining permit holders to secure environmental guarantees before conducting operations.
The affected companies are located across regions including East Kalimantan, Central Kalimantan, South Sumatra, Southeast Sulawesi, Bangka Belitung, West Nusa Tenggara, and North Maluku.
The suspension, effective immediately, will be automatically lifted if the companies immediately submit reclamation plan documents and place a reclamation guarantee through 2025, the letter stated.
During the suspension period, which can last up to 60 days, companies must continue mine management and environmental protection activities in their permit areas.
The Director General warned that failure to comply with the deadline could result in permanent revocation of business permits.
This is the government's commitment to enforcing reclamation regulations for the sake of environmental sustainability and mining safety, according to Tri Winarno.
